TentiCL Modular Edge Compute Platforms are turnkey, factory-built infrastructure systems designed for rapid deployment and scalable performance. Each MDC integrates IT racks, power distribution, cooling, security, fire suppression, and monitoring into a standardized, transportable solution.

TentiCL delivers rapidly deployable, energy-efficient modular data center infrastructure designed to meet the evolving demands of AI, cloud, and edge computing worldwide. Our factory-built modules integrate redundant power, precision cooling, security, and fire suppression into standardized intermodal enclosures that can be deployed and operational in weeks.
From compact edge deployments to multi-megawatt colocation environments, TentiCL’s modular architecture enables organizations to scale compute capacity on demand. This approach reduces deployment timelines, optimizes capital efficiency, and provides a future-ready foundation for emerging technologies and sustained growth.
